What will you learn?

  • Yoga  History & Philosophy, Lifestyle & Ethics 
    • History of Yoga
    • Living Your Yoga
    • Yoga Sutras
    • Ethics
  • Techniques, Training and Practice
    • Yoga Poses
    • Yoga Styles
      • Hatha (Vinyasa), Restorative, Yin, Yoga Nidra, & Chair 
    • Pranayama/Breathing Techniques
    • Meditation & Mindfulness
    • Neuroscience 
    • Making Yoga Accessible for Seniors & Curvy Bodies
  • Teaching Methodology
    • Setting the Stage for Class
    • Adjusting and Assisting
    • The Business of Yoga
  • Anatomy and Physiology
    • Applying anatomy and physiology principles to yoga practice including benefits, contraindication, and healthy movement
    • Study of Subtle Energy Anatomy
      • Sound Healing, Chakras, Ayurveda & Mudras
  • Practice Teaching
    • Practice teaching as the lead instructor
    • Receiving and giving feedback with peers
    • Observing peers teach

When is the training?

If you’d like the in person experience or live virtual, the training will take place on Saturday & Sunday from 9A – 3P on the dates below. All sessions will be recorded. If there are any conflicts with the dates, simply watch the recording at your convenience. 

June 1 & 2 
July 6 & 7 
August 3 & 4 
September 7 & 8 
October 5 & 6 
November 2 & 3
December 7 & 8 
January 4 & 5 
February 1 & 2 
March 1 & 2 
April 5 & 6 
April 26 & 27

Who is the lead facilitator?

Me! Shannon Stricklin, the creator and visionary of The Studio. I quit my 25 year career in the telecommunications industry to open a yoga studio and become a yoga teacher. I’ve been teaching 12 years and have taught nearly 6,000 classes. I’ve practiced yoga for more than 17 years and graduated my 8th class of yoga training students this month.

I consider my classes a fusion of all the yoga that I love including hatha, restorative, yin, yoga nidra and whatever I create. It’s increasingly important that my classes are inclusive for all humans – including seniors and curvier folks.

What is the cost?

  • $100 Registration Fee – Pay Now
  • $3000 for Training Certification or $250 per month for 12 months. The payment will be processed the first Friday of each month. 
  • The cost for required reading is not included in tuition.
  • The cost does not include registration with Yoga Alliance if you choose to do so. We are a Registered Yoga School with Yoga Alliance. 

There will be a few books you will need to purchase to supplement your learning. Unlimited yoga classes at The Studio is included during your training. Yes! You read that right.
